This is a list of the women Heads of State in the past 50 years.

1. Sirimavo Bandaranaike, Sri Lanka
Prime Minister, 1960-1965, 1970-1977, 1994-2000.
2. Indira Gandhi, India
Prime Minister, 1966-77, 1980-1984.
3. Golda Meir, Israel
Prime Minister, 1969-1974.
4. Isabel Peron, Argentina
President, 1974-1976
5. Elisabeth Domitien, Central African Republic
Prime Minister, 1975-1976
6. Margaret Thatcher, Great Britain
Prime Minister, 1979-1990.
7. Maria da Lourdes Pintasilgo, Portugal
Prime Minister, 1979-1980.
8. Lidia Gueiler Tejada, Bolivia
Prime Minister, 1979-1980.
9. Dame Eugenia Charles, Dominica
Prime Minister, 1980-1995.
10. Vigdís Finnbogadóttír, Iceland
President, 1980-96.
11. Gro Harlem Brundtland, Norway
Prime Minister, 1981, 1986-1989, 1990-1996.
12. Soong Ching-Ling, Peoples' Republic of China
Honorary President, 1981.
13. Milka Planinc, Yugoslavia
Federal Prime Minister, 1982-1986.
14. Agatha Barbara, Malta
President, 1982-1987.
15. Maria Liberia-Peters, Netherlands Antilles
Prime Minister, 1984-1986, 1988-1993.
16. Corazon Aquino, Philippines
President, 1986-92.
17. Benazir Bhutto, Pakistan
Prime Minister, 1988-1990, 1993-1996.
18. Kazimiera Danuta Prunskiena, Lithuania
Prime Minister, 1990-91.
19. Violeta Barrios de Chamorro, Nicaragua
Prime Minister, 1990-1996.
20. Mary Robinson, Ireland
President, 1990-1997.
21. Ertha Pascal Trouillot, Haiti
Interim President, 1990-1991.
22. Sabine Bergmann-Pohl, German Democratic Republic
President, 1990.
23. Aung San Suu Kyi, Myanmar (Burma)
Her party won 80% of the seats in a democratic election in 1990, but the military government refused to recognize the results. She was awarded the Nobel Peace Prize in 1991.
24. Khaleda Zia, Bangladesh
Prime Minister, 1991-1996.
25. Edith Cresson, France
Prime Minister, 1991-1992.
26. Hanna Suchocka, Poland
Prime Minister, 1992-1993.
27. Kim Campbell, Canada
Prime Minister, 1993.
28. Sylvie Kinigi, Burundi
Prime Minister, 1993-1994.
29. Agathe Uwilingiyimana, Rwanda
Prime Minister, 1993-1994.
30. Susanne Camelia-Romer, Netherlands Antilles
Prime Minister, 1993, 1998-
31. Tansu Çiller, Turkey
Prime Minister, 1993-1995.
32. Chandrika Bandaranaike Kumaratunge, Sri Lanka
Prime Minister, 1994, President, 1994-
33. Reneta Indzhova, Bulgaria
Interim Prime Minister, 1994-1995.
34. Claudette Werleigh, Haiti
Prime Minister, 1995-1996.
35. Sheikh Hasina Wajed, Bangladesh
Prime Minister, 1996-.
36. Mary McAleese, Ireland
President, 1997-.
37. Pamela Gordon, Bermuda
Premier, 1997-1998.
38. Janet Jagan, Guyana
Prime Minister, 1997, President, 1997-1999.
39. Jenny Shipley, New Zealand
Prime Minister, 1997-1999.
40. Ruth Dreifuss, Switzerland
President, 1999-2000.
41. Jennifer Smith, Bermuda
Prime Minister, 1998-.
42. Nyam-Osoriyn Tuyaa, Mongolia
Acting Prime Minister, July 1999.
43. Helen Clark, New Zealand
Prime Minister, 1999-.
44. Mireya Elisa Moscoso de Arias, Panama
President, 1999-.
45. Vaira Vike-Freiberga, Latvia
President, 1999-.
46. Tarja Kaarina Halonen, Finland
President, 2000-.
